📅  最后修改于: 2023-12-03 15:17:26.867000             🧑  作者: Mango
在SQL中,我们通常处理的数据类型包括整型、浮点型、字符型等等,但是在某些情况下,数据可能会非常长,例如博客文章、新闻内容、商品详情等。这时,我们需要使用longtext
数据类型来存储这些大文本数据,以便能够完整地保存它们。
longtext
是一种用于在MySQL和其他一些关系型数据库中存储大量文本数据的数据类型。它可以存储长度达到4294967295个字符的文本数据,这是其他数据类型所无法比拟的。使用longtext
可以确保我们有足够的存储空间来保存所有文本数据,而且不会丢失任何内容。
使用longtext
非常简单。在创建表格时,我们只需要将相应的数据列的数据类型设置为longtext
即可。例如,下面是一个用于保存博客文章的表格:
CREATE TABLE `blog` (
`id` INT(11) UNSIGNED NOT NULL AUTO_INCREMENT,
`title` VARCHAR(255) NOT NULL DEFAULT '',
`author` VARCHAR(255) NOT NULL DEFAULT '',
`content` LONGTEXT NOT NULL,
PRIMARY KEY (`id`)
);
在这个表格中,我们创建了一个名为blog
的表格,其中包含了title
、author
和content
三个列。title
和author
列是普通的varchar
类型,用于存储博客标题和作者信息,而content
列是一个longtext
类型,用于存储博客文章内容。
使用longtext
存储大量文本数据有许多优点。以下是一些重要的优点:
存储空间:longtext
可以存储非常大的文本数据,而其他数据类型则可能无法存储这么多内容。
完整性:使用longtext
可以确保我们存储了所有的文本数据,而不会导致数据丢失或截断。
灵活性:使用longtext
可以处理各种类型的文本数据,包括HTML、XML、JSON等,而不会影响数据的完整性和准确性。
longtext
是一种非常有用的数据类型,适合存储大量文本数据。无论您是在开发博客、电子商务网站还是其他类型的数据驱动应用程序,都可以使用longtext
来保存您的数据。希望本文能够对您有所帮助!